The Wrath to Come pt 2

The Beginning

the-wrath-to-come is only the beginning, because for the true son or daughter of the King, the wrath directed at the enemy, at the threat, is a divine grace. The general understanding I see people have is to take the position that we're all God's kids, so any anger/wrath he exhibits against anyone is somehow a contradiction to his loving nature.

His demonstration of wrath towards his enemies is a great proof of the love he has for his children though. If everyone erroneously takes a view that we're all God's children then there's not any room to talk about the enemies of God. YOU are the enemy! As was I... and it's by God's divine love and sovereignty that I have been adopted into his family. It's by nothing more than love and sovereignty that anyone is adopted.

If you are a child of the King, then wrath is only the beginning, because the rest of that story is of protection and love. Humanity gets hung up on wrath thinking we're the good guys and God owes us one, but this isn't a Biblical worldview.

When people talk about god, god's wrath, god's love, etc... I like to ask "which god?" because a lot of people aren't talking about my God, the True God-King, when they make claims about love and wrath... Most people want a grandpa in the sky too senile to recognize when they've done something wrong - but my King is the farthest thing from that caricature and his grand love for his people will be shown in many ways. Watching his wrath from behind the angelic armies will look much more like grace and love than hatred and anger, but for the enemies of God facing him at the front I'm sure 'wrath' will be all they see.

Choices

Life is made up of choices, and I don't think making a choice based on fear is ideal. I do not think that anyone can will themselves, by fear or not, to "accept Jesus" - ie. saving faith in the Lord isn't something anyone can arrive at on their own, it is a gift.

So the question is, when the gift is sat in front of you, the gift of adoption and eternal life, divine and eternal grace, do you accept it? Or let it pass by... Because that choice dictates a lot about how God looks at you. He's either protecting you from his enemies, or you are his enemy. And to be honest, when the enemies of God try to slander his name by calling him hateful and referring to wrath as though it should change the reality of who he is - all I see are enemies and propaganda. I know my God loves me, it's been proven over and over.

Yahweh is not a senile old man in the sky, he is the conquering King and he will protect his own. So thank God for love and wrath.
